Russia makes competitive commercial shipbuilding a priority

Matthew White, of Dolphin Exhibitions, takes a look at how the Russian market is developing, helped by a push from government, particularly in terms of its Arctic sea routes

Russia’s renewed focus on the commercial shipbuilding industry was set as a key aim by Prime Minister, Dmitry Medvedev in his recent discussions on the development of the sector throughout 2015. The 2015 impetus on competitive opportunity coincides with the 13th International Maritime Exhibition and Conferences of Russia – NEVA 2015.
